Content is the most important thing on your site. It is what sets you apart from competitors. It is why users visit you, search engines rank you and advertisers buy digital inventory

Page 12: Content

1. Create original content2. Update regularly3. Know your audience and what they want4. Use social media for exposure and reach5. Make all content meaningful

Five tips
